-- | ESAM SignalProcessingNotification data defined by
-- OC-SP-ESAM-API-I03-131025.
--
-- /See:/ 'newEsamSignalProcessingNotification' smart constructor.
data EsamSignalProcessingNotification = EsamSignalProcessingNotification'
  { -- | Provide your ESAM SignalProcessingNotification XML document inside your
    -- JSON job settings. Form the XML document as per
    -- OC-SP-ESAM-API-I03-131025. The transcoder will use the signal processing
    -- instructions in the message that you supply. Provide your ESAM
    -- SignalProcessingNotification XML document inside your JSON job settings.
    -- For your MPEG2-TS file outputs, if you want the service to place SCTE-35
    -- markers at the insertion points you specify in the XML document, you
    -- must also enable SCTE-35 ESAM (scte35Esam). Note that you can either
    -- specify an ESAM XML document or enable SCTE-35 passthrough. You can\'t
    -- do both.
    sccXml :: Prelude.Maybe Prelude.Text
  }
  deriving (Prelude.Eq, Prelude.Read, Prelude.Show, Prelude.Generic)
